We achieve balance with a mixture of sensory information from the central nervous system, mobility, and strength. When any of these are compromised, balance can be lost. Balance problems can occur in the elderly when there is dysfunction with the inner ear, nerves, heart, eyes, joints, muscles and bones, which must all act in unison. …
In order to understand hypertension or high blood pressure, it is important to know what blood pressure actually is. Blood pressure is the force of blood pushing against the walls from within arteries. This pressure changes throughout the day as blood is transported from your heart to other body organs. What is it? Lumbar spinal stenosis is a narrowing of one of the canals in the lumbar spine. Many people with spinal stenosis have no symptoms. Sometimes however, this canal narrowing can put pressure on nerves which might result in pain, numbness, tingling or weakness in the low back or into the buttocks and legs.…
